Discharges of certain industrial waste water into receiving watersE+W
8.—(1) This regulation applies to discharges of biodegradable industrial waste water from plants representing 4,000 p.e. or more belonging to the industrial sectors listed in Schedule 5 which does not enter urban waste water treatment plants before discharge to receiving waters.
[F1(2) The Environment Agency must impose, in every environmental permit with respect to any discharge on or after 31st December 2000 to which this regulation applies, conditions which are appropriate to the nature of the industry concerned for the discharge of such waste water.]

(4) All lakes and ponds shall be treated as controlled waters for the purposes of the enactments mentioned in [F3paragraph (2)] above insofar as they relate to discharges to which this regulation applies.
